The Hyers Sisters' Dream & Legacy is a fascinating look at the lives of the Hyers Sisters, who were breaking barriers in the 1870s and 80s. The documentary captures a unique historical moment, blending their operatic aspirations with a deep commitment to social justice. The pacing flows between poignant interviews and archival footage, giving a real sense of their struggles and triumphs. It's not just about their music but how they became Voices for Freedom, intertwining art and activism. The performances—both musical and personal—are striking, showing their resolve and talent in an era that was anything but kind to them. You get a real feel for the atmosphere of the time and how their legacy resonates even today.
